Preliminary Investigation and Evaluation Report— California Cedar Products <br /> 5.2 TPH-d, BTEX and Fuel Oxygenates in Soil <br /> • Total Petroleum hydrocarbons as diesel TPH-d was detected in B1 at a <br /> maximum concentration of 6,900 mg/Kg at 13 feet bgs and at 18 feet bgs and <br /> decreased in concentration horizontally and vertically below 19 feet bgs, <br /> BTEX compounds were at low to non-detect levels Benzene was detected at <br /> 1 5 mg/Kg at 23 feet bgs in sample B3-3 Toluene was detected at 0 89 mg/Kg <br /> at 23 feet bgs in sample B2-3 Ethyl benzene ranged from 0 31 mg/Kg in sample <br /> B2-3 to 4 1 mg/Kg in sample 133-3 Total xylenes ranged from 0 02 mg/Kg in <br /> sample B2-3 to 2 3 mg/Kg in sample 133-3, <br /> Fuel oxygenates were not detected <br /> 5.3 Groundwater Sampling <br /> • TPH-d was detected in the groundwater sample collected from the hydropunch <br /> at B4 at a concentration of 2,600 ug/L, <br /> Benzene and toluene were at non-detectable levels, ethylbenzene was detected <br /> at 34 ug/L, and total xylenes were detected at 7 1 ug/L, <br /> oxygenates were detected in groundwater <br /> No fuel oxyg <br /> 5.4 Recommendations <br /> The following work is suggested to further characterize the horizontal extent of the <br /> diesel-range hydrocarbons identified by this investigation <br /> • Install five additional soil probes to terminate in the clay bed at 25 feet bgs (see <br /> Figure 6- Proposal Map), Analyze soil at 23 feet bgs to establish the Non- <br /> RAB Consulting <br /> 10 <br />
